Cast of Leave the World Behind
Academy Award-winning actress Julia Roberts takes on the complex role of Amanda, the lead character in Rumaan Alam’s apocalyptic novel “Leave The World Behind,” showcasing her talent for portraying a liberal, modern woman who confronts her own prejudices and weaknesses during a crisis. Roberts’ excitement for the project even led to the potential casting of Denzel Washington, her former co-star from “The Pelican Brief,” in the role of G.H., but unfortunately, it didn’t materialize. The anticipation of their reunion generated a fierce competition for the adaptation rights of Alam’s bestselling book.
Mahershala Ali, a two-time Academy Award winner known for his performance in “Moonlight,” portrays George G.H. Washington, the affluent black owner of the Long Island Airbnb. Alongside Myha’la Herrold from “Industry,” they disrupt the idyllic vacation of Amanda and Clay, played by Ethan Hawke, known for his surprising and diverse roles. Hawke’s character, as a husband and father, will face challenges in his attempts to protect his family.

Kevin Bacon, renowned for his reliable performances in films like “A Few Good Men,” portrays Danny, the capable and dependable contractor who built the Washingtons’ perfect house. G.H. considers Danny a close friend and relies on him for survival guidance during the apocalypse. The cast also includes Farrah Mackenzie from “Logan Lucky” as Rosie and Charlie Evans from “Everything’s Gonna Be Okay” as Leonard.
Leave the World Behind Story
The official synopsis via Netflix reads:
“A family vacation on Long Island is interrupted by two strangers bearing news of a mysterious blackout. As the threat grows more imminent, both families must decide how best to survive the potential crisis, all while grappling with their own place in this collapsing world.“
Crew of Leave the World Behind
Excitement builds as Netflix secures the highly anticipated December release of this apocalyptic film, backed by an impressive lineup of industry giants. Sam Esmail, the acclaimed director and screenwriter, leads the project while also adapting the script. Rumaan Alam, the author of the novel, assumes the role of executive producer. The production team includes notable figures such as Julia Roberts, Chad Hamilton, Lisa Gillan, and Marisa Yeres Gill as producers.

Netflix emerges triumphant in a fierce competition that involved Apple, MGM, and various other studios and streaming platforms, all vying for the rights to adapt the book even before its release. Garnering critical acclaim, the novel became a finalist for the 2020 National Book Award and received accolades from influential figures like Barack Obama, who listed it among his Summer Favorites. It was also recognized as one of the best books of 2020 by NPR, The Washington Post, The New Yorker, The LA Times, and numerous other reputable sources.
